Take a moment, breathe, and understand your body has been through a tremendous shock.  You were pumped full of liquids via IV, you're swollen from surgery and healing, and you'll get there.  I struggled my first month and was totally cranky about the lack of loss.  Your doctor is right...just do what you're supposed to do.  Maybe weigh yourself once a week or once every two weeks for a while?  Take this time to learn new healthy habits, walk, get your liquids and protein.  A year from now you won't recognize yourself!!

If you haven't already, take your measurements! It will help you stay motivated when you hit inevitable stalls. It's hard to notice results in the mirror, so take lots of photos so you can compare yourself down the road. The first month is tough, a lot of people don't lose a whole lot and you're totally normal! It's way too easy to compare ourselves to others but there are a lot of factors at play that contribute to each person's weight loss. Stay the course and you will see results, I promise!
